Playing at digital casinos can be a exciting experience, but it's important to be cautious of scams that try to cheat players. Think about you sign up at any site, take these steps to secure yourself:

* First, check for licensing information. Reputable casinos display their license number prominently on their website.

* Second, read the terms and conditions carefully. This will help you understand the rules of the casino.

* Don't fall to promises of unrealistically big payouts or guaranteed wins. If it sounds too good to be true, it probably is.

Remain informed about common online casino scams and flag any suspicious activity to the appropriate authorities. Remember, playing at reputable casinos and taking precautions can provide a safe and enjoyable gambling experience.
